How To Fix MILL_OC095 - Combined processes cannot be deleted


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: MILL_OC - Messages for order combination

  • Message number: 095

  • Message text: Combined processes cannot be deleted

  • Show details Hide details
  • <ZK>&CAUSE&</>
    In the original order, you tried to delete a combined operation.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    If you want to delete a combined operation, you must
    technically close the (not yet released) combined order by choosing
    <ZK>Restrict processing -> Close technically</>
    then delete the operation in the original order

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message MILL_OC095 - Combined processes cannot be deleted ?

    The SAP error message MILL_OC095: Combined processes cannot be deleted typically occurs in the context of the SAP Mill Products industry solution, particularly when dealing with combined processes in production planning or order management.

    Cause:

    This error message indicates that you are attempting to delete a combined process that is currently in use or has dependencies that prevent its deletion. Combined processes are often used to manage complex production scenarios where multiple operations are linked together. If there are existing orders, dependencies, or references to the combined process, SAP will not allow you to delete it to maintain data integrity.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can follow these steps:

    1. Check Dependencies: Investigate if there are any production orders, planned orders, or other references that are linked to the combined process you are trying to delete. You can use transaction codes like CO03 (Display Production Order) or CO02 (Change Production Order) to check for any active orders.

    2. Remove Dependencies: If you find any dependencies, you will need to either complete, cancel, or delete those orders before you can delete the combined process. Ensure that all related processes are either finished or appropriately handled.
